Distinguish 18th Century English Knotty Pine Panel Room
Located in North Salem, NY
Transform your space into a captivating den, library, or office with the grandeur of this remarkable 18th-century English pine panel room. Every wall is adorned with intricately crafted applied mouldings, adding depth and character to the room. The craftsmanship is truly exceptional, showcasing the skilled artistry of the era. There are four door/window openings, each adorned with a beautifully carved Greek key moulding, providing a touch of elegance and sophistication. These openings offer opportunities for natural light to flow into the room, creating an inviting ambiance. The room is divided into distinct sections. The lower section comprises eight panels, adding a sense of solidity to the room's design. The mid section is accentuated by eight meticulously crafted mouldings, enhancing the visual appeal and providing a transition between the lower and upper panels. The upper section consists of twelve panels, further enriching the overall aesthetic. To crown this magnificent space, a dentil carved moulded cornice elegantly tops...

Wood Paneled Room with Trompe L oeil Library Decoration, Late 20th Century
Located in SAINT-OUEN-SUR-SEINE, FR
This piece of woodwork was made at the extreme end of the 20th century, around 1985 and comes from a Parisian mansion. It presents a grey paneled decoration enhanced with gold, composed of empty shelves surmounted by cupboards opening with a leaf, or filled with trompe l'oeil books by great authors with old bindings. The shelves are punctuated by protruding ionic columns on rudent pedestals. Three doors give access to the room, two of which are trompe l'oeil, taking up the library decor...
